liquid nitrogen cell shippers are designed to safely store and transport biological samples at ultra-low temperatures, typically around -196 degrees Celsius. This ensures that the cells remain frozen and intact during transit, reducing the risk of degradation or contamination. The use of liquid nitrogen as a coolant provides a stable and consistent environment for the cells, preserving their viability for extended periods.

In addition to their durability, liquid nitrogen cell shippers offer superior temperature control compared to traditional dry ice shippers. While dry ice can sublimate and lead to temperature fluctuations, liquid nitrogen provides a more stable and consistent cooling environment. This allows for the safe preservation of cells and samples without the risk of thawing or damage during transit.

liquid nitrogen cell shippers also have the advantage of being reusable and refillable, making them a cost-effective and sustainable solution for transporting biological samples. Instead of relying on single-use packaging materials, researchers and healthcare professionals can simply refill the shippers with liquid nitrogen for continued use. This not only reduces waste but also lowers the overall cost of sample transportation, making it a more environmentally friendly option for the biotechnology industry.

Furthermore, liquid nitrogen cell shippers offer a high level of security and traceability for the samples being transported. Many shippers are equipped with tracking devices and monitoring systems that provide real-time data on the temperature and location of the samples. This ensures that the samples are kept at the optimal temperature throughout the journey and allows for immediate intervention in case of any discrepancies. The ability to track and monitor samples in real-time provides researchers and healthcare professionals with greater confidence in the integrity and quality of the transported cells.
